CRF450 Exhaust on F4i

I have a brand new CRF450 exhaust here. It's an FMF. Holding it up next to my F4i exhaust it seems to have the exact same bend and I think it'll work. Has anyone ever tried to mount one up? It's a quiet series FMF pipe and I'm thinking IF it'll mount up it might be real nice and give me some more back pressure.
